Best Buy Co. Inc. shares continue to trade in the low-60 USD range on the New York Stock Exchange after the U.S. electronics retailer released its Q1 FY2027 results on 05/28/2026, providing the latest snapshot of demand for consumer technology and home appliances in its core United States market, according to MarketBeat as of 06/04/2026.MarketBeat as of 06/04/2026

On 05/28/2026, Best Buy reported Q1 FY2027 diluted earnings per share of USD 1.28 on revenue of USD 8.94 billion, with the revenue figure up 1.9% year-over-year and above analyst estimates of USD 8.82 billion, according to MarketBeat as of 06/04/2026.MarketBeat as of 06/04/2026

As of the latest available delayed quote on 06/04/2026, Best Buy traded at around USD 62.98 per share on the NYSE, with a trailing price-earnings ratio of about 13.3 based on trailing EPS of USD 5.40, according to Morningstar as of 06/04/2026.Morningstar as of 06/04/2026

For German investors, Best Buy is also accessible via secondary listings on venues such as Tradegate under the ticker BBY, where it is quoted in euro, though liquidity and spreads typically differ from trading on the home U.S. exchange.

Best Buy Co. Inc.: core business model

Best Buy operates large-format stores and digital channels that specialize in consumer electronics, appliances and technology services, with revenue mainly generated from product sales complemented by warranties, memberships and installation or support offerings.

Industry trends and competitive position

Best Buy is active in the North American consumer electronics retail industry, a segment that is closely tied to upgrade cycles in smartphones, computing devices, televisions and household appliances, and where omnichannel capabilities and service offerings have become central to differentiation.

According to Morningstar as of 06/04/2026, Best Buy is considered a pure-play consumer electronics retailer in the United States, reflecting its focus on technology products rather than broader general merchandise, and positioning it against competitors such as Amazon in online sales and Walmart and Target in big-box physical retail.Morningstar as of 06/04/2026

Industry data providers highlight that U.S. consumer electronics demand has been normalizing after pandemic-era spikes, with replacement demand for laptops, televisions and gaming devices supporting baseline volumes while discretionary big-ticket purchases remain sensitive to macroeconomic conditions, according to sector commentary from S&P Global published in 2026.S&P Global as of 2026

Within this environment, Best Buy competes by combining store-based product displays and in-person advice with online ordering, curbside pickup and delivery options, seeking to maintain share in categories where online penetration is high and price transparency is significant.

Service offerings such as Geek Squad support, extended warranties and technology consultations are used to differentiate Best Buy from pure online players and to stabilize margins in product segments that can be price-competitive.
